A Lovely Little Daydream

Listen to poem:
To sit and daydream upon the farthest hill
Let my eyes wander across a meadow green
Conceive of rainbows whose colors spill
And paint the sky with a glorious sheen

Free my mind to drift like children spin 
And find a child like joy to fulfill
To picture little feet as they run again
Trying to capture the light of day until

Escape to skies of sunsets and starlight
Lose myself in beauty they beseech
To fly on wings like creatures now in flight
As they glide horizons out of reach

Dream of worlds my mind will come to form
And want a life that's filled with waterfalls 
Where colored wings of butterflies begin to swarm
To daydream on this hill 'till forever calls
